An elevated, static view captures a portion of the City of Edinburgh, United Kingdom, under an overcast sky. In the immediate foreground, a weathered stone wall extends horizontally, featuring a series of six visible arched, recessed panels. Beyond this wall, the midground is occupied by the corrugated metal and glass sawtooth roof structures of Waverley Station. In the background, prominently positioned slightly left of center, is the large, ornate, grey stone facade of The Balmoral Hotel, characterized by numerous windows and a distinctive clock tower topped with a finial and flag. To the right of The Balmoral, additional historic city buildings are visible, followed by a distant cityscape on a higher elevation, featuring a prominent, slender spire and other architectural elements.
